About the Game

Disc golf is a fast-growing sport played competitively and for fun by people of all ages. It is easy to learn, inexpensive, and great exercise. Players throw a disc (similar to a Frisbee) from a tee towards a "hole" as they would in traditional golf. Every throw is a stroke. The holes are baskets equipped with hanging chains that help to "catch" the thrown disc. The tees are marked with a post planted flat on the ground. Players tee-off from behind these posts.

Directions

The Dallas Disc Golf Course is located in the the Brandvold (new) section of the park. Access via the entrance located at 401 Southwest Levens Street and head west at Brandvold Drive.
